Risk of damage to appliance. The neutralization kit inlet and discharge must be at a lower elevation
than the condensate drain from appliance.
Do not allow exhaust flue gases to vent through the neutralization kit. All condensate drains must
have a trap to prevent flue gas leakage. Flue gas leakage can cause injury or death from carbon
monoxide.
Connection to the appliance and neutralization kit must be installed to ensure that no condensate
backflow into the appliance can occur.

WHAT TO DO IF YOU SMELL GAS
Do not try to light any appliance.
Do not touch any electrical switch; do not use any phone in your building.
Immediately call your gas supplier from a neighbor' s phone.
Follow the gas supplier' s instructions.
If you cannot reach your gas supplier, call the fire department.
DO NOT store or use gasoline or other flammable vapors and liquids near this or
other appliances.

    Background on the Pentair ETi® 250 Heater and Condensation The Pentair ETi® 250 Heater is a condensing appliance. The heater’ s flue gases will produce condensate while the heater is in operation and the condensate must be drained correctly. Note: The condensate pH level is between 3.1 and 4.2. Pentair recommends that the condensate be neutralized to avoid potential damage over time to the drainage system, and to comply with local water authorities where applicable.
